摘要
Purpose How can people with lived experiences of marginalisation actively participate in contesting their marginalisation? This article aims to review the literature on PAR as a research approach. It will first describe what PAR means and consider this approach's particular features. The paper will go on to explore the advantages, limitations and criticisms of this approach to research. Design/methodology/approach How can people with lived experiences of marginalisation actively participate in contesting their marginalisation? The approach of this paper is to provide needed viewpoint discussion on Participatory Action Research (PAR) advantages, limitations and criticisms. PAR is mostly a qualitative research approach that takes account of researchers and participants collaborating to investigate social issues and take actions to bring about social change. Findings The aim of (PAR) is to systematically collect and analyse data to take action and make a change by generating practical knowledge. However, PAR as an approach to research has advantages and disadvantages. Also, PAR as an approach can be a problematic tool for facilitators and communities to apply due to power relations within the research process. However, PAR can help the praxis of collective critical consciousness of the participation and democratisation of participants presented in studies where this approach is used. Although a PAR approach can be an unknown and challenging tool, it is a path through which communities can explore their society and ignite to change it. Originality/value This paper provides a discussion of the critical consciousness value of PAR that seeks to bring academics, researchers and practitioners to the approach to primarily qualitative research methodology that should be understood with advantages, limitations (ethical challenges) and criticisms.
